I rode 1 hr 43 minutes in a race recently with no blisters. I would have blisters if I only wore mx gloves. I use the kevlar glove liners with the fingers and thumb cut off about 1/2" down from where the skin connects your fingers together. I clip the thumb off just behind the thumb nail so the thumb joint is still covered.
